Nancy’s path to art began as a jewelry artist. Her father was a stone setter, and she remembers watching him set stones. Once her children left the nest, she felt she had to fill the void. She began making jewelry and from there entered her first glass class. She learned how to make glass cabochons and incorporated them into her jewelry pieces. The glass technique she uses is called fused glass. This is where glass is “bonded” together in a kiln using various heat temperatures.
From making small pieces of glass, she explored creating larger pieces and became fascinated with glass even further. Nancy immersed herself in the glass world by producing sculptural pieces of art. Nancy loves challenging herself by continually learning new techniques to incorporate into her glasswork. Glass is always moving, and so is she.
Nancy has been part of numerous fine art shows in Arizona and California. She feels that her art is a true reflection of herself, and she hopes you will find a personal connection to her work and her love of art.

My inspiration comes from the ocean, which is reflected in many of my pieces. I also love abstract and Kandinsky has always been a tremendous inspiration.
